Susie Carmicle's plant was designed to produce 8,000 screwdrivers per day but is limited to making 5,000 screwdrivers per day because of the time needed to change equipment between styles of screwdrivers. What is the utilization?

For the past month, the plant which has an effective capacity of 6,300, has only made 3,900 screwdrivers per day because of material delay, employee absences, and other problems. What is its efficiency?

If a plant has an effective capacity of 6,200 and an efficiency of 86%, what is the actual(planned) output?
Material delays have routinely limited production of household sinks to 300 units per day. If the plant efficiency is 85%, what is the effective capacity?
